Output 75d281c4938c0becc6643dd62d280a03a02bf0ae8bdc5f3edc6ec9cc269958a4:1

value
1620030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d7834e30a5d635e538c46a3378f88b30bbe7a6d OP_EQUAL
address
37J39M14AhntEfVB2UEztXbJuAsHWYrYzS
transaction
75d281c4938c0becc6643dd62d280a03a02bf0ae8bdc5f3edc6ec9cc269958a4
confirmations
222404
spent
true